Output 966f61b91f25dfcee5255c33ba720a57e8b5008887154b74ce35ec5e0063249c:0

value
528893240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60a4cfa407b1c9005fc428da0723cf87cdaf215f OP_EQUAL
address
3AW2EEbYd22EUjfAxexw1hcXtP9X5ALVT9
transaction
966f61b91f25dfcee5255c33ba720a57e8b5008887154b74ce35ec5e0063249c
spent
true